What is a physics major?

A physics major is a science degree path that helps explain how the world works and how the universe is structured. Majors study matter and energy and gain exposure to both classical and modern theories in the field. Students also spend time completing experiments in a lab setting.

Is physics a tough major?

In general, coursework at the college level is designed to be challenging. Physics is certainly no exception. In fact, physics is considered by most people to be among the most challenging courses you can take. One of the reasons physics is so hard is that it involves a lot of math.

Is physics a high paying major?

Physics bachelors are highly employable, in a variety of career paths. A physics bachelor’s degree now ranks higher in starting salary than many other technical fields (including mechanical engineering). The typical starting salary for a physics bachelor degree has increased by nearly $10,000 since 2003.
